Skip the Amalfi Coast — Go to Sardinia Instead

Summer’s almost here, which means the Amalfi Coast is about to be packed. That’s why we’re making the case for Sardinia instead — which is equally stunning, but with a fraction of the crowds.

Make Cagliari, the capital, your base and spend your days wandering narrow alleyways in the Castello district (don’t miss sunset at the city’s best lookout point), relaxing on spectacular beaches, spotting pink flamingos at Molentargius Saline Regional Natural Park, sampling the island’s “longevity wine” (which may or may not explain Sardinia’s Blue Zone status), and embracing slow living over aperitivi in lively piazzas.

As for whether you extend your trip to the ridiculously glamorous Costa Smeralda or the tiny hillside town home to “The World’s Rarest Pasta”? We’ll leave that up to you.
